body {
	font-family: Arial, Helvetica; color: black; 
	font-size: 10pt; 
/*	background-image: url('szofi_vizjel.bmp'); */
	background-color: white;
	color: black;
}
.teszt {
	background-image: url('consulting.jpg');
}
body.reg {
	font-size: 10pt; 
	text-align: center;
}
p { font-family: Arial, Helvetica; }
p.lab { 
		  font-size: 8pt; 
}
table {
	font-size: 10pt; 
}

:link { color: #000099; }
:visited { color: brown; }
/* :hover { color: blue; }

.fejlec { color: #ffffff; font-family: Arial, Helvetica; font-size: 12pt; }
.bg1 { background-color: #000000; color: #ffffff; }
.bg3 { background-color: #000099; color: #ffffff; }
.c1 { font-size: 250%; font-family: Times; letter-spacing: 3pt;  color: #ffffff; }
table.fejlec tr td { font-size: 120%; font-weight: bold; }
table.fejlec tr th { font-size: 120%; font-weight: bold; }
table.fejlec tr th.cim { font-size: 150%; height: 80px; background-color: #cc0000; color: #ffffff; }
table.fejlec tr th a { color: white; }
table.fejlec tr th a:link { color: white; }
table.fejlec tr th a:visited { color: white;  }
table.fejlec tr td a { color: white; }
table.fejlec tr td a:link { color: white; }
table.fejlec tr td a:visited { color: white;  }

body.head {
		background-color: white;
}

h1 {
 	font-family: Arial, Helvetica; color: black; 
	font-size: 22pt;
	font-weight: normal;

}
h1.cim { font-size:16pt; text-align: center; }
h2 { font-family: Arial, Helvetica; color: black; 
	font-size:20pt; 
}
h3 { font-family: Arial, Helvetica; color: black; 
	font-size:14pt; 
}
h4 { font-family: Arial, Helvetica; color: black; 
	font-size:12pt; 
}

h5 { font-family: Arial, Helvetica; color: black; 
	font-size:12pt; 
}
td.question { font-weight: bold; }
td.single {  /*background-color: white;	    
	    padding-width: 5cm; */ }

